Abstract
A kind of radiating lamp, including task module, radiating subassembly, LED illumination component and guard assembly.Task module includes support frame, panel and heat-conducting plate, and panel is set on support frame, and heat-conducting plate is set to panel far from the one side of support frame.Radiating subassembly includes that radiating bottom plate, heat radiation rack, motor, radiating vane, connection curved bar, mounting table, multiple first mounting discs and multiple second mounting discs, radiating bottom plate are set to heat-conducting plate far from the one side of panel.LED illumination component includes multiple first luminescence components and multiple second luminescence components.Guard assembly includes protective ring and multiple elastic rods, and the first end of each elastic rod is connect with mounting table, and the second end of each elastic component is connect with protective ring.Above-mentioned radiating lamp can more in all directions illuminate the sample being placed on mounting table, can satisfy lighting demand when user observes sample, and light can also preferably be collected to the utilization rate for improving light on to the sample, illuminating effect is preferable.

For a further understanding of above-mentioned radiating lamp, another example is, referring to Fig. 1, radiating lamp 10 includes: operation
Component 100, radiating subassembly 200 and LED illumination component 300, radiating subassembly 200 are set in task module 100, LED illumination group
Part 300 is set in task module 100.
Referring to Fig. 1, task module 100 includes support frame 110, panel 120 and heat-conducting plate 130, panel 120 is set to branch
On support 110, workspace of the panel 120 as user, for example, the drafting instrument that the panel is used to place user is e.g. used for
Place the tools such as magnifying glass and the gage of user.
Referring to Fig. 1, heat-conducting plate 130 is set on one side of the panel 120 far from support frame 110, in this way, the pen of user
Remember this computer, e.g., high-performance and the big notebook computer of heat dissipation capacity are placed on the heat-conducting plate, in this way, these high-performance and dissipating
The heat that the big notebook computer of heat generates can be absorbed by the heat-conducting plate, and then be transferred to described dissipate by the heat-conducting plate
On hot component, and by the radiating subassembly by heat loss into external environment, to ensure that these high-performance and heat dissipation capacity are big
Notebook computer can normally work, and meet the drawing demand of user.
Referring to Fig. 1, radiating subassembly 200 includes radiating bottom plate 210, heat radiation rack 220, motor 230, radiating vane 240, connects
Connect curved bar (not shown), mounting table 250, multiple first mounting discs 260 and multiple second mounting discs 270, radiating bottom plate 210, electricity
Machine 230, multiple first mounting discs 260 of the connection curved bar and multiple second mounting discs 270 are connect with heat radiation rack 220 respectively.
Referring to Fig. 1, radiating bottom plate 210 is set on one side of the heat-conducting plate 130 far from panel 120, heat radiation rack 220
First end is set on one side of the radiating bottom plate 210 far from heat-conducting plate 130, and radiating bottom plate 210 is used to connect with heat-conducting plate 130
It connects, for by being transferred in the overall structure of the radiating subassembly on heat-conducting plate 130, e.g., radiating bottom plate 210 is by heat-conducting plate
Being transferred on the heat radiation rack on 130, for playing heat spreading function.
Referring to Fig. 1, motor 230 is set in the second end of heat radiation rack 220, the rotation of radiating vane 240 and motor 230
The first end of axis connection, the connection curved bar is connect with heat radiation rack 220, and the connection curved bar is connect with mounting table 250, mounting table
Interval is provided between 250 and heat radiation rack 220, in this way, when sample is placed on mounting table 250, can allow user preferably
Sample is observed, and then preferably draws out the map file of the sample.For example, the heat radiation rack includes multiple radiating fins, it is each described
A side of radiating fin is connected with each other, and forms leaf wheel-like structure, interior to form multiple heat dissipation channels, in conjunction with the radiating vane
Ventilation effect, can preferably improve heat dissipation effect.
Referring to Fig. 1, each interval of first mounting disc 260 is compassingly set on the edge of radiating bottom plate 210, every one first peace
The one side of sabot 260 towards mounting table 250 is provided with the first mounting surface.Each interval of second mounting disc 270 is compassingly set at scattered
On the edge of hot frame 220, the one side of each second mounting disc 270 towards the mounting table 250 is provided with the second mounting surface, institute
It states the first mounting surface and second mounting surface is used to install the LED illumination component.First mounting disc 260 and the second installation
Interval is provided between disk 270, in this way, the outgoing of more conducively light, reduces the disturbed problem of light and occur.For example, described
First mounting disc is shifted to install with second mounting disc, in this way, being more advantageous to raising illuminating effect.
Referring to Fig. 1, LED illumination component 300 includes multiple first luminescence components 310 and multiple second luminescence components 320,
Every one first luminescence component 310 is arranged in a one-to-one correspondence on first mounting surface of one first mounting disc 260, for example, described
First luminescence component includes multiple first LED light, and each first LED light is set to first peace of first mounting disc
On dress face.Every one second luminescence component 320 is arranged in a one-to-one correspondence on second mounting surface of one second mounting disc 270.Example
Such as, second luminescence component includes multiple second LED light, and each second LED light is set to the institute of second mounting disc
It states on the second mounting surface, in this way, passing through first mounting disc and first luminescence component cooperation and second installation
Disk and second luminescence component cooperate, and can illuminate more in all directions to the sample being placed on the mounting table, energy
Enough meet lighting demand when user observes sample, and above structure can preferably collect light on to the sample, mention
The high utilization rate of light, reduces stimulation of the light to user.In addition, by the way that first mounting disc and described second is arranged
Mounting disc can satisfy the radiating requirements of high brightness and the big LED light of calorific value, can quickly and in time by heat loss extremely
In external environment.
Above-mentioned radiating lamp 10 is by being arranged task module 100, radiating subassembly 200 and LED illumination component 300, and benefit
With the cooperation of radiating subassembly 200 and LED illumination component 300, can more in all directions to the sample being placed on mounting table 250 into
Row illumination can satisfy lighting demand when user observes sample, and can also preferably collect light on to the sample,
The utilization rate of light is improved, illuminating effect is preferable.
